Debatable

Debatable adjective - Open to question or dispute.
Usage example: it's always debatable which college football team is really number one, since there's more than one ranking system

Inarguable

Inarguable adjective - Not capable of being challenged or proved wrong.
Usage example: the colonists presented their case for political independence with what they regarded as inarguable logic
